Windows Media Management Troubleshooting
Removable Storage and Media Management in Windows
This is essential reading if you are having problems with media management and removable storage under Windows.
BackupAssist will manage the media automatically, but if you are migrating from a different backup system and you are
using old tapes, then you may need to do a few additional tasks. This document explains how.
